SIGSTKSZ is -1 in glibc 2.34 #4

glibc 2.34 sets the SIGSTKSZ constant to -1 when _GNU_SOURCE or _SC_SIGSTKSZ_SOURCE are defined: https://sourceware.org/git/?p=glibc.git;a=commitdiff;h=6c57d320484988e87e446e2e60ce42816bf51d53

This caused a number of issues in various projects, e.g., vim/vim#7895. It also breaks the default stack size logic when using create_fcontext_stack(0). The suggested alternative is apparently sysconf(_SC_SIGSTKSZ), which has the downside of being GNU/Linux specific.
